2021-22 Season Notes (RFr.): Owns team-best five double-doubles … Opened season with double-double (17 points, 11 rebounds) vs. SIUE (Nov. 9) … Posted back-to-back double-doubles for first time in career with identical performance against New Hampshire (Nov. 12) … Scored 21 points on 5-of-8 shooting from deep versus Ole Miss (Nov. 18) in the Charleston Classic … Named to All-Tournament Team after leading team to championship game and to BIG EAST Honor Roll (Nov. 22) … Finished with 23 points and 11 rebounds in win over Providence (Jan. 4) … Scored game-winning 3-pointer with 11.9 seconds left in 57-54 victory at Villanova (Jan. 19) … Named BIG EAST Player of the Week (Jan. 24) for first time in career … Also named Naismith Men’s Player of the Week (Jan. 24) … Netted personal-best 33 points on 11-of-19 shooting in win at Seton Hall (Jan. 26) … Named to BIG EAST Honor Roll (Jan. 31) … Scored 28 points and grabbed seven rebounds in win over St. John's (Mar. 5) … Named to ALL-BIG EAST First Team (Mar. 6)  … Named BIG EAST Most Improved Player (Mar. 7) … Led the league in scoring (18.2 ppg.) in conference games. 

2020-21 Season Notes (Fr.): Scored 10 points in collegiate debut vs. UAPB (Nov. 25) … Followed that effort up with 10 points and eight rebounds against Eastern Illinois (Nov. 27) … Grabbed 13 rebounds vs. Ok. State (12/1) … Finished with 18 points against No. 4 Wisconsin (Dec. 4), including game-winning tip-in at the buzzer on missed free throw … Named BIG EAST Freshman of the Week (Dec. 7) … Chipped in 11 points and nine rebounds in win at nationally ranked Creighton (Dec. 14) … Scored 8-of-10 points in second half at Georgetown (Jan. 2) and added seven rebounds … Chipped in 11 points, six rebounds and three blocked shots in 22 minutes against Providence (Jan. 12) … Shot 4-of-6 from the floor and finished with 13 points and seven rebounds at St. John’s (Jan. 16) … Chipped in 12 points and eight rebounds in 35 minutes of action at Providence (Jan. 27) … returned to the court at UConn (Feb. 27) after missing majority of previous seven games with ankle injury … Scored 14 points off the bench against the Huskies …  made first start of season at DePaul (March 2).

Prior to Marquette:  Consensus nationally ranked prep prospect, rated by ESPN.com, 247Sports.com and Rivals.com … A three-year letterwinner at Baltimore Polytechnic Institute … Helped the program to two-straight state titles (three overall) under head coach Sam Brand in 2018 and 2019 … Engineers became the first public school program in state history to claim three consecutive Class 3A championships … Concluded three-year career with 1,374 points, third most in program history … As a senior, was a Maryland Basketball Coaches Association First Team All-State honoree …  Also an all-metro honoree and named co-player of the year … Team finished 24-2 … Averaged 19.3 points, 13.4 rebounds and 4.4 blocked shots per game in 2019-20 … Concluded the season with 18 double-doubles … First team all-city pick as a junior … Averaged 17.3 points and 9.2 rebounds, 3.4 assists and 3.2 blocks per game and finished with 16 double-doubles … Earned all-metro first team accolades for the second-straight season and was named All-USA Maryland Basketball Second Team by USA Today … In 2017-18, claimed second team all-metro honors and was also tabbed second team all-state … Engineers also earned a city championship en route to the state title … Attended Calvert Hall High School as a freshman in 2016-17 and has competed on the summer league circuit with Team Melo … Participated in the 2019 Men’s Junior National Team minicamp in October.

Personal:  Born April 12, 2002 in Baltimore, Maryland … Son of Chantia Richardson and Keith Lewis … One of six siblings (Kennedy Carpenter, Ryan Lewis, James Taylor, Shynard Lewis, Keshawn Lewis) … Majoring in communications.
